Centennial Colorado Surety Request — Show Cause Hearing is a legal process that serves as a formal procedure for individuals or organizations within Centennial, Colorado, to request surety or bond in relation to show cause hearings. A show cause hearing typically occurs when a party fails to comply with a court order or fails to provide valid reasons for non-compliance. This process ensures that the party at fault provides a monetary guarantee, known as surety or bond, to assure their appearance and compliance with future court orders. The Centennial Colorado Surety Request — Show Cause Hearing may encompass various types based on the specific situation or the party seeking surety. Some common variations include: 1. Civil Show Cause Hearing: This type of hearing may be held in civil cases where the court requires an explanation from a party regarding their failure to comply with a previous court order. The party seeking surety may be required to provide a bond as collateral to guarantee future compliance. 2. Criminal Show Cause Hearing: In criminal cases, when a person violates the terms of their probation or fails to appear in court, a show cause hearing may be ordered. The individual may be required to request surety or bond to secure their appearance and compliance, ensuring they address the reasons behind their non-compliance. 3. Family Court Show Cause Hearing: Show cause hearings in family court usually revolve around child custody, visitation, or support issues. If a party fails to uphold their responsibilities or abide by court orders, a show cause hearing may be initiated. The party seeking surety may be obligated to provide a bond to ensure future compliance. 4. Business Show Cause Hearing: This type of hearing typically focuses on non-compliance with regulations or court orders related to businesses within Centennial, Colorado. Businesses failing to adhere to legal requirements may face a show cause hearing, where they may be required to request surety or bond as a guarantee of fulfilling their obligations and rectifying the non-compliance. Overall, the Centennial Colorado Surety Request — Show Cause Hearing involves individuals or businesses seeking surety or bond as a legal obligation to show compliance and guarantee future appearances in court. It plays a vital role in upholding the integrity of court orders and ensuring accountability within Centennial, Colorado's legal system.
